#6243a4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6243a4 is composed of 38.4% red, 26.3%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 59.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 259.2 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 45.3%. #6243a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#c486ff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#6243a4 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#6243a4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6243a4 has RGB values of R:98, G:67,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 6439844.

Shades and Tints of #6243a4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06040b is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6243a4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726f78 is the less saturated color, while #4c05e2 is the most saturated one.
